What type of temperature is this? It’s 2,200 ohms at room temperature
Reply #22025-07-06
At room temperature, the resistance is around 2200 ohms; this sensor is likely a temperature sensor of the PTC thermistor type. The analysis is as follows: - The resistance values of common platinum resistive temperature sensors (such as Pt100, Pt1000) at room temperature are usually around 100 ohms or 1000 ohms; they do not reach over 2000 ohms. - The resistance value of NTC thermistors is generally between a few thousand and several tens of thousands of ohms at room temperature, but it drops rapidly as the temperature rises. Therefore, at room temperature, the resistance value of an NTC is generally much higher than 1KΩ, usually ranging from several thousand to several tens of thousands of ohms. - PTC thermistors have a low resistance at room temperature, and this resistance increases rapidly as the temperature rises; therefore, it is possible for their initial resistance to be between a few hundred and a few thousand ohms. The value of 2200 ohms that you measured matches these characteristics. Based on the above characteristics, your sensor with a resistance of around 2200 ohms at room temperature is likely to be a PTC-type thermistor temperature sensor. .
